Azerbaijani oil price falls

The price of a barrel of Azerbaijani Azeri Light crude oil on the global market fell by $6.35, or 6.55%, to $90.5, a market source told Report.

Following trading, the price of August futures for Brent crude stood at $88.23.

The price of Azerbaijani oil on an FOB basis at Türkiye's Ceyhan port decreased by $6.33, or 6.69%, to $88.23 per barrel.

Azerbaijan's state budget for this year is based on an oil price of $65 per barrel.

The lowest price for Azeri Light was recorded on April 21, 2020, at $15.81, while its highest price was registered in July 2008, at $149.66.

Oil in Azerbaijan is produced mainly under the agreement on the development of the Azeri-Chirag-Gunashli (ACG) block of fields. The State Oil Company of Azerbaijan (SOCAR) holds a 31.65% stake in the contract.
